]> SALOME platform Git repositories - modules/shaper.git/blobdiff - src/SketcherPrs/CMakeLists.txt
Salome HOME
Migration to OpenCASCADE CMake configuration.
[modules/shaper.git] / src / SketcherPrs / CMakeLists.txt
index c443483236c830f317f53048ce148f20f856290a..48d35ffb6ff60fed0120c06d2867be7644bf0bfd 100644 (file)
@@ -77,12 +77,9 @@ SET(PROJECT_LIBRARIES
     GeomAPI
     GeomDataAPI
     Events
-    ${CAS_KERNEL}
-    ${CAS_MODELER}
-    ${CAS_VIEWER}
-    ${CAS_SHAPE}
-    ${CAS_TKTopAlgo}
-    ${CAS_TKOpenGl}
+    ${OpenCASCADE_FoundationClasses_LIBRARIES}
+    ${OpenCASCADE_ModelingAlgorithms_LIBRARIES}
+    ${OpenCASCADE_Visualization_LIBRARIES}
     ${FREETYPE_LIBRARIES}
 )
 
@@ -108,7 +105,7 @@ SET(PROJECT_PICTURES
     icons/translate.png
 )
 
-ADD_DEFINITIONS(-DSKETCHERPRS_EXPORTS ${CAS_DEFINITIONS} -D_CRT_SECURE_NO_WARNINGS)
+ADD_DEFINITIONS(-DSKETCHERPRS_EXPORTS ${OpenCASCADE_DEFINITIONS} -D_CRT_SECURE_NO_WARNINGS)
 ADD_LIBRARY(SketcherPrs SHARED ${PROJECT_SOURCES} ${PROJECT_HEADERS})
 
 INCLUDE_DIRECTORIES(
@@ -119,7 +116,7 @@ INCLUDE_DIRECTORIES(
   ${PROJECT_SOURCE_DIR}/src/GeomAPI
   ${PROJECT_SOURCE_DIR}/src/GeomDataAPI
   ${PROJECT_SOURCE_DIR}/src/SketchPlugin
-  ${CAS_INCLUDE_DIRS}
+  ${OpenCASCADE_INCLUDE_DIR}
   ${FREETYPE_INCLUDE_DIRS}
 )